A cover page is the first page of an essay, which provides essential information about the essay and its author. It typically includes the essay’s title, the author’s name, the course name and number, the instructor’s name, and the date. How to Make a Cover Page for an Essay

A cover page is an essential part of any essay. It provides important information about the essay and its author, and it can also help to make a good impression on the reader. Here are 10 key aspects to consider when creating a cover page for an essay:

  • Title: The title of your essay should be clear and concise, and it should accurately reflect the content of the essay.
  • Author: Your name should be listed on the cover page, along with your contact information.
  • Course: The name of the course for which the essay is being written should be listed on the cover page.
  • Instructor: The name of the instructor for the course should be listed on the cover page.
  • Date: The date the essay was submitted should be listed on the cover page.
  • Formatting: The cover page should be formatted according to the style guide specified by your instructor.
  • Font: The font used on the cover page should be easy to read and professional looking.
  • Margins: The margins on the cover page should be set according to the style guide specified by your instructor.
  • Spacing: The spacing on the cover page should be consistent and visually appealing.
  • Overall appearance: The cover page should be neat, clean, and free of errors.

  • Legibility matters: Just like a clear and concise writing style, a legible font makes it easier for the reader to focus on your content rather than struggling to decipher the words. Sans-serif fonts like Arial, Helvetica, or Calibri are popular choices for their readability, especially when viewed on a screen.
  • Professionalism shines through: The font you choose conveys a message about your work. A professional-looking font, such as Times New Roman, Georgia, or Garamond, exudes a sense of seriousness and credibility. Avoid using overly decorative or whimsical fonts, as they may distract from the content and undermine the essay’s impact.
  • Consistency is key: While you may be tempted to experiment with different fonts, it’s generally advisable to stick to one or two fonts throughout your cover page. This creates a cohesive and polished look that complements the overall presentation of your essay.
  • Size it right: The font size should be large enough to be easily readable, without being overpowering. A font size of 12 or 14 points is typically appropriate for cover pages.
